Mau Bujrg
Mau Bujrg is a village located in Gola tehsil of Gorakhp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Gola (tehsildar office) and 10km away from district headquarter Gorakhpur. As per 2009 stats, Belsara is the gram panchayat of Mau Bujrg village.

About Mau Bujrg
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mau Bujrg is 187922. The village spans a total geographical area of 5127.6 hectares. Gola is nearest town to Mau Bujrg village for all major economic activities.

Population of Mau Bujrg
According to the 2011 Census, Mau Bujrg has a total population of about 731, with approximately 377 males and 354 females. The sex ratio is around 938 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 51 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 198 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population includes 1 person. The overall literacy rate is approximately 89.74%, with male literacy at about 88.33% and female literacy near 91.24%. There are around 104 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Mau Bujrg's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 731 | 377 | 354 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 51 | 34 | 17 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 198 | 100 | 98 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 1 | 1 | N/A |
Literate Population | 656 | 333 | 323 |
Illiterate Population | 75 | 44 | 31 |
Connectivity of Mau Bujrg
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mau Bujrg. As per the 2011 stats, Mau Bujrg had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
